Regulations on application documents shall be in Chinese

Under the Patent Law and the Implement Regulations of Patent Law, any document to be submitted shall be in Chinese. A standard technical terminology shall be used if it is uniformly provided by the State. Where there is no uniform Chinese translation for the name of a foreigner, a foreign locality or a foreign technical terminology, the term in the original language shall be indicated.

Where any certificate or certified document which is to be submitted in accordance with the Patent Law or these Rules is in a foreign language, the administrative department for patent under the State Council may, when considered necessary, request the party concerned to submit a Chinese translation within a specified time limit; where the translation has not been submitted at the expiry of the time limit, the certificate or certified document shall be deemed to have not been submitted.
